MIDDLETOWN – Temperatures in the upper 20s did not dissuade hundreds of people from attending the annual Middletown Christmas parade and tree lighting at John F. Degnan Festival Square on Friday evening.

Residents from the city and neighboring towns lined the street while Degnan Square saw hundreds of people standing shoulder to shoulder.

The parade included the Middletown High School marching band followed by firetruck carrying Santa himself on the back.

He then went up in a cherry picker to flip the switch and light the tree to the cheers, oohs and ahhs of all in attendance.
